React Js Tutorial Pdf

Advertisement

React JS tutorial PDF: Your Ultimate Guide to Learning ReactJS Efficiently

React JS has revolutionized front-end web development with its component-based architecture, virtual DOM, and efficient rendering capabilities. Whether you're a beginner or an experienced developer aiming to deepen your understanding, accessing a comprehensive React JS tutorial PDF can be a game-changer. This article provides an in-depth guide on finding, utilizing, and mastering React JS through PDF tutorials, ensuring you have all the information needed to kickstart or enhance your React journey.

---

Understanding React JS and Its Importance

React JS, developed by Facebook, is an open-source JavaScript library primarily used for building interactive user interfaces. Its component-driven approach allows developers to create reusable UI components, making complex applications more manageable. As the demand for dynamic and responsive web applications grows, React JS remains one of the top choices among developers worldwide.

Why Learn React JS?

- Component-Based Architecture: Simplifies development and maintenance.
- Virtual DOM: Improves app performance by minimizing DOM manipulations.
- Large Ecosystem and Community: Offers extensive resources, tutorials, and support.
- SEO Friendly: Supports server-side rendering for better SEO performance.
- Cross-Platform Development: Enables mobile development via React Native.

---

Benefits of Using a React JS Tutorial PDF

Utilizing a PDF tutorial for learning React JS offers several advantages:

- Offline Accessibility: Learn anytime without needing internet access.
- Structured Content: Well-organized chapters and sections facilitate systematic learning.
- Comprehensive Coverage: In-depth explanations, code snippets, and examples.
- Portability: Easy to download, print, and review at your convenience.
- Resource for Revision: Acts as a quick reference guide during development.

---

How to Find Quality React JS Tutorial PDFs

Finding the right PDF tutorial requires careful consideration. Here are some reliable sources and tips:

Trusted Websites and Platforms

- Official React Documentation: The official docs contain tutorials and guides (though not always as PDFs, but can be converted).
- Educational Platforms: Udemy, Coursera, and edX often provide downloadable resources.
- Programming Blogs and Websites: Medium, Dev.to, and freeCodeCamp offer free PDFs and e-books.
- Open Source Repositories: GitHub repositories may contain comprehensive React tutorials in PDF or Markdown formats that can be converted.

Tips for Selecting the Best PDF Tutorials

- Check the Publication Date: Ensure the content is recent, especially with React's rapid updates.
- Review the Table of Contents: Confirm it covers beginner to advanced concepts.
- Read User Reviews: Feedback from other learners can help gauge quality.
- Verify Author Credentials: Established authors or organizations lend credibility.
- Look for Supplementary Resources: Examples, exercises, and solutions enhance learning.

---

Essential Topics Covered in a React JS PDF Tutorial

A comprehensive React JS tutorial PDF should cover foundational to advanced topics. Here’s what you should look for:

1. Introduction to React JS

- What is React?
- History and evolution
- Why choose React over other frameworks

2. Setting Up the Development Environment

- Installing Node.js and npm
- Using Create React App
- IDE and code editors (VS Code, WebStorm)

3. React Fundamentals

- JSX syntax
- Components (Functional and Class Components)
- Props and State
- Lifecycle Methods

4. Working with React Components

- Creating reusable components
- Passing data via props
- Managing component state

5. Handling Events and User Input

- Event binding
- Forms and input handling
- Validation

6. React Hooks

- useState
- useEffect
- Custom hooks
- Rules of hooks

7. State Management

- Context API
- Redux introduction (if covered)

8. Routing and Navigation

- React Router setup
- Link and NavLink components
- Route parameters

9. Working with APIs

- Fetching data with fetch or Axios
- Async/Await
- Displaying data dynamically

10. Styling in React

- CSS Modules
- Styled-components
- Inline styles

11. Testing React Applications

- Jest basics
- React Testing Library

12. Building and Deployment

- Building production-ready apps
- Deployment options (Netlify, Vercel, GitHub Pages)

---

Sample Outline for a React JS Tutorial PDF

To help you identify what to expect, here is a sample outline of a well-structured React JS tutorial PDF:

1. Introduction
2. Prerequisites
3. Environment Setup
4. React Basics
- JSX
- Components
- Props and State
5. Advanced Concepts
- Hooks
- Context API
- Redux
6. Routing and Navigation
7. API Integration
8. Styling Techniques
9. Testing
10. Deployment
11. Best Practices
12. Conclusion and Next Steps

---

Tips for Making the Most Out of a React JS PDF Tutorial

- Follow Along with Examples: Practice coding as you read.
- Take Notes: Summarize key concepts for quick revision.
- Experiment: Modify examples to understand their behavior.
- Build Projects: Apply your knowledge by creating small projects.
- Join Communities: Engage with forums like Stack Overflow, Reddit, or Reactiflux.

---

Additional Resources to Complement Your PDF Learning

While a React JS tutorial PDF is valuable, supplement your learning with:

- Official React Documentation: https://reactjs.org/docs/getting-started.html
- Online Courses: Platforms like Udemy, Coursera, and Pluralsight.
- YouTube Tutorials: Free video guides from channels like freeCodeCamp, Traversy Media.
- Practice Platforms: CodeSandbox, CodePen, JSFiddle.

---

Conclusion

A well-crafted React JS tutorial PDF can serve as a cornerstone in your web development journey. It offers a structured, portable, and comprehensive resource that helps you grasp core concepts and advanced techniques at your own pace. By choosing high-quality PDFs, actively practicing, and supplementing your learning with real-world projects and community support, you'll be well on your way to becoming proficient in React JS.

Remember, consistency and hands-on practice are key. Start with the basics, progressively move to advanced topics, and don't hesitate to revisit your PDF resources whenever needed. Happy React learning!

---

FAQs

Q1: Are free React JS tutorial PDFs reliable?
A1: Many free PDFs are created by reputable developers and educational platforms. Always verify the source and publication date to ensure quality and relevance.

Q2: How often should I update my React knowledge?
A2: React releases updates regularly. Keep an eye on official documentation and community blogs to stay current.

Q3: Can I learn React from a PDF if I am a complete beginner?
A3: Yes, but ensure the PDF is beginner-friendly, explains fundamental concepts clearly, and includes practical examples.

Q4: Where can I find free React JS tutorial PDFs?
A4: Platforms like GitHub, freeCodeCamp, and educational blogs often provide free downloadable resources.

Q5: Is knowledge of JavaScript necessary before learning React?
A5: Absolutely. A solid understanding of JavaScript fundamentals is essential for effective React development.

---

Embark on your React JS learning journey today with the right PDF tutorial and turn your web development aspirations into reality!

Frequently Asked Questions


Where can I find comprehensive React JS tutorial PDFs for beginners?

You can find comprehensive React JS tutorial PDFs on official documentation sites like React's official website, educational platforms such as Udemy or Coursera, and free resource repositories like GitHub or SlideShare.

Are there any free React JS tutorial PDFs available for advanced learners?

Yes, many free PDFs catering to advanced learners are available on platforms like GitHub, Dev.to, and community forums, covering topics like Hooks, Context API, and performance optimization.

How do I choose the best React JS tutorial PDF for my learning level?

Select PDFs that match your experience level—beginner PDFs focus on basics like components and JSX, while advanced PDFs cover state management, hooks, and testing. Read reviews or table of contents to ensure relevance.

Can I use React JS tutorial PDFs offline for learning?

Absolutely, once downloaded, React JS tutorial PDFs can be used offline, making them a convenient resource for learning without internet access.

Are there updated React JS tutorial PDFs that cover the latest version?

Yes, look for PDFs published or updated after the release of React 18 or the latest version, ensuring they include recent features like Concurrent Mode and automatic batching.

How effective are PDF tutorials compared to online video tutorials for React JS?

PDF tutorials are great for detailed, step-by-step reading and reference, while videos can provide visual demonstrations. Combining both methods can enhance understanding and retention.